Submitted (1 edit) (+1)

Fast paced retro game straight out of the arcade, I love it :)

Shooting is implemented perfectly, I especially liked the effect of a loaded weapon. But the control of the ship at high speed is not very responsive because of this, it is sometimes quite difficult to control the movement.

After a few attempts, I thought, why should I move at all? And I just stood still and fired at the enemies. Perhaps it makes sense to add some enemies that would shoot at the player in order to motivate him to move, and not stand still.

The sound effects are well chosen, but I missed some background music, it would give the game an extra atmosphere.

In general, I really liked it, my best result is 36800 points :D

Great job!

By the way, great particle systems :)

Submitted(+1)

The game is a good rendition of the asteroid shooter genre and the sounds are really nice. The gameplay was smooth and intuitive. In the future it would be nice to have a BG that is easier on the eyes and maybe some powerups to make the gameplay more exciting? The blast cannon is cool, but it can get repetitive if you're aiming for a really high score. We found the movements to be a bit on the hard side with how fast it can get if you keep the button pressed for too long but we understand the thought behind it as it does make you feel very mobile as well compared to a side-scroller type of gameplay. Maybe some brake function could have done the trick!
You seem very passionate about space shooter games so we hope this feedback can help you improve on something that you will keep developing in the future. :)
